Additional information

This paper combines geotechnical, fluid mechanics and geophysical concepts. Debris flows are modelled for the first time under enhanced g in order to investigate fundamental scaling principles towards modelling of erosion processes. This research was undertaken in collaboration with Prof. Sarah Springman at Institute für Geotechnik, ETH Zurich.
